What Affects Electrical Repair Costs in Centerville?

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ises

πŸ“Š

labor costs

Leon County electricians often charge rates lower than big Texas cities due to rural location. Experienced licensed pros command more, especially for specialized work like EV charger installs. Travel from nearby areas can add fees for outlying properties.

πŸ“Š

market dynamics

Limited pool of qualified electricians in Centerville means demand spikes after storms or peak seasons can lift prices. Steady local economy keeps baseline competitive, but shop multiple bids.

πŸ“Š

seasonal trends

Summer AC overloads and winter heater issues drive up urgent repair demand. Post-storm periods see price surges from backlog.

🧱 Key Pricing Components

  • βœ“ Labor: Hourly rates based on skill and time needed.
  • βœ“ Materials/Parts: Wiring, breakers, fixturesβ€”prices fluctuate with supply.
  • βœ“ Diagnostic Fees: Initial troubleshooting to identify issues.
  • βœ“ Travel & Permits: Distance and code requirements add costs.
  • βœ“ Urgency Premium: Evenings, weekends, or emergencies cost more.

How to Save Money on Electrical Repair

Smart strategies to get quality service without overpaying

πŸ—£οΈ

Tip

Get 3+ written quotes from licensed, insured local electricians.

πŸ—£οΈ

Tip

Provide clear details on the problem and access for accurate estimates.

πŸ—£οΈ

Tip

Ask for itemized breakdowns: labor, parts, fees, timeline.

πŸ—£οΈ

Tip

Inquire about warranties, cleanup, and payment terms.

πŸ—£οΈ

Tip

Verify TX licensing via TDLR website.

⚠️ Watch Out For

Pricing Red Flags

Warning Sign

Too-low quotesβ€”often mean subpar work, unlicensed, or bait-and-switch.

Warning Sign

No written estimate or pressure to pay upfront fully.

Warning Sign

Hidden fees popping up later like 'trip charges' or 'shop supplies'.

Warning Sign

Verbal guarantees without contract.

Warning Sign

Unwilling to discuss alternatives or scope.

Pricing Questions

Common questions about electrical repair costs in Centerville

πŸ’¬ What drives up electrical repair costs in Centerville?

Job complexity, emergency timing, premium parts, and permit needs primarily affect totals.

Local demand after weather events can also play a role.

πŸ’¬ How do I get fair quotes for electrical repairs?

Describe symptoms precisely, mention any recent issues, and request itemized bids from multiple pros.

Visit during quote for accuracy.

πŸ’¬ Are there typical price ranges for common fixes?

Simple tasks like GFCI outlet replacement tend to be lower.

Full room rewires or panel work range much higher based on scale.

Quotes tailored to your home are essential.

πŸ’¬ Do electrical repairs in TX require permits?

Often yes for major work like panels, additions, or service changes.

Leon County enforces NEC codesβ€”confirm with local building dept.

Licensed pros handle this.

πŸ’¬ What hidden fees should I watch for?

Travel/mileage, after-hours surcharges, disposal, or restocking.

Demand upfront breakdown to avoid surprises.

πŸ’¬ Is it worth paying more for a master electrician?

Absolutely for complex or safety-critical jobs.

Experience reduces risks, callbacks, and ensures code compliance.

Check reviews and licensing.
